Flying High in OM Yoga Magazine

February 21, 2019 Tobias Oliver
image1.jpg

I’m super excited to be featured in March edition of OM Yoga Magazine as this month’s, ‘Man on the Mat’.

Really, I am. Even if I do look a bit serious in the photo; I’m just concentrating on keeping the correct alignment as I balance on a tree stump.

In the article I guide you through one of my favourite asanas, the Eagle Pose (Garudasana) - a strengthening and balancing standing pose. (Please note; a tree stump is optional. I just couldn’t resist having the photo taken in my favourite local Sheffield park on a sunny Winter day).

There are so many benefits to be gained from the Eagle Pose. Such as strengthening muscles in the hips, thighs, calves and ankles, and improving flexibility in the shoulders, hips and ankles.

What’s more, as a balancing pose it requires focus and coordination, improving stamina, resilience and concentration. (Hence, my serious ‘concentrating hard’ face!)

You’ll have to get hold of your own copy of the March 2019 OM Yoga Magazine to discover even more benefits to be gained from Garudasana and to learn a few tips on how to practise this pose.

Then you too will be flying high!
